Dr. Jared Piper, one of two Veterinarians at the Scott Air Force Base Veterinary Treatment Facility, prepares the medications for a patient prior to a teeth cleaning procedure, Scott AFB, Ill., Nov. 4, 2014. He combines the medications, when possible, to reduce the amount of shots given to the patient prior to anesthesia. The Scott AFB Vet serves not only military families’ animals, but also serves Security Forces military working dogs. (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man 1st Class Erica Crossen)
